​ May 30, Tokyo, Japan This is the Reddit post from May 3, just 27 days ago, when Ochiai ran an astounding 1'43''90 at the 41st Shizuoka International Athletics Meet in Shizuoka, Japan. Today, at MDC 2026 (Twolaps Middle Distance Circuit) in Tokyo, Japan, he smashed his own national record again by 0.45 seconds. The breath-taking 1'43''45 time also places him the second best ever in Asia. The previous time he held, 1'43''90, had been the fourth. Our AR is still the 1'42''79 from 2008 by the Kenya-born Bahraini runner Yusuf Saad Kamel. Ochiai is currently in his second year of college and will be 20 years old in August. submitted by /u/a_windmill_mystery [link] [comments]
